A Poisson algebra is a Lie algebra endowed with a commutative associative product in such a way that the Lie and associative products are compatible via a Leibniz rule. If we part from a Lie color algebra, instead of a Lie algebra, a graded-commutative associative product and a graded-version Leibniz rule we get a so-called Poisson color algebra (of degree zero). This concept can be extended to any degree, so as to obtain the class of Poisson color algebras of arbitrary degree. This class turns out to be a wide class of algebras containing the ones of Lie color algebras (and so Lie superalgebras and Lie algebras), Poisson algebras, graded Poisson algebras, z-Poisson algebras, Gerstenhaber algebras, and Schouten algebras among other classes of algebras. The present paper is devoted to the study of structure of Poisson color algebras of degree g0, where g0 is some element of the grading group G such that g0 = 0 or 4g0≠0, and with restrictions neither on the dimension nor the base field, by stating a second Wedderburn-type theorem for this class of algebras.  相似文献

The n-dimensional p-filiform Leibniz algebras of maximum length have already been studied with 0 ≤ p ≤ 2. For Lie algebras whose nilindex is equal to n−2 there is only one characteristic sequence, (n − 2, 1, 1), while in Leibniz theory we obtain the two possibilities: (n − 2, 1, 1) and (n − 2, 2). The first case (the 2-filiform case) is already known. The present paper deals with the second case, i.e., quasi-filiform non-Lie-Leibniz algebras of maximum length. Therefore this work completes the study of the maximum length of the Leibniz algebras with nilindex n − p with 0 ≤ p ≤ 2.  相似文献

I set out the theory of Schunck classes and projectors for soluble Leibniz algebras, parallel to that for Lie algebras. Primitive Leibniz algebras come in pairs, one (Lie) symmetric, the other antisymmetric. A Schunck formation containing one member of a pair also contains the other. If ? is a Schunck formation and H is an ?-projector of the Leibniz algebra L, then H is intravariant in L. An example is given to show that the assumption that the Schunck class ? is a formation cannot be omitted.  相似文献

Iwasawa algebras are completed group algebras of compact p-adic Lie groups. Ardakov and Venjakob have studied the structure theory and the ring-theoretic properties of such algebras. This article gives an explicit presentation by generators and relations of the Iwasawa algebras of uniform pro-p groups, i.e. the pro-p groups that admit a p-adic analytic manifold structure.  相似文献
